Uses
Esomeprazole Gastro-resistant tablets are indicated in adults for:
Gastroesophageal Reflux Disease (GERD) - Treatment of erosive reflux esophagitis. - Long-term management of patients with healed esophagitis to prevent relapse. - Symptomatic treatment of g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D). In combination with appropriate antibacterial therapeutic regimens for the eradication of Helicobacter pylori and - Healing of Helicobacter pylori associated duodenal ulcer.
- Prevention of relapse of peptic ulcers in patients with Helicobacter pylori associated ulcers. Patients requiring continued NSAID therapy - Healing of gastric ulcers associated with NSAID therapy. - Prevention of gastric and duodenal ulcers associated with NSAID therapy, in patients at risk.

Uses
1 INDICATIONS AND USAGE Esomeprazole magnesium delayed-release capsules are a proton pump inhibitor (PPI).
Esomeprazole magnesium delayed-release capsules are indicated for the:
Short-term treatment in the healing of erosive esophagitis (EE) in adults and pediatric patients 12 years to 17 years of age. 1 ) Maintenance of healing of EE in adults. 2 ) Short-term treatment of heartburn and other symptoms associated GERD in adults and pediatric patients 12 years to 17 years of age.
3 ) Risk reduction of n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AID)-associated gastric ulcer in adults at risk for developing gastric ulcers due to age (60 years and older) and/or documented history of gastric ulcers. 4 ) Helicobacter pylori eradication in adult patients to reduce the risk of duodenal ulcer recurrence in combination with amoxicillin and clarithromycin.
5 ) Long-term treatment of pathological hypersecretory conditions, including Zollinger-Ellison syndrome in adults. 1 Healing of Erosive Esophagitis (EE) Adults Esomeprazole magnesium delayed-release capsules are indicated for the short-term treatment (4 to 8 weeks) in the healing and symptomatic resolution of diagnostically confirmed EE in adults.
